Rhyne Howard & Allisha Gray Lead Dream to Victory Over Mercury (2026)

In the world of women's basketball, a captivating clash unfolded between the Atlanta Dream and Phoenix Mercury. The Dream, eager to rebound from a recent loss, showcased a remarkable performance, securing a 96-82 triumph. This game was a testament to the team's resilience and the standout talents of Rhyne Howard and Allisha Gray.

The duo's synergy was evident, as they collectively amassed 43 points. Howard, a rising star, displayed her versatility with 23 points, 6 rebounds, and 8 assists. Her court vision and playmaking abilities were on full display, orchestrating the Dream's offense with precision. Meanwhile, Gray contributed 20 points, showcasing her scoring prowess and providing a much-needed boost to the team's momentum.

The Mercury, despite the loss, had their moments too. Guard Kelsey Plum, a recent acquisition, showed glimpses of her potential with 19 points and 5 rebounds. However, the Dream's defense managed to contain her impact, limiting her overall effectiveness.
